The President of Turkmenistan and the Foreign Minister of India share the opinions on the priorities of interstate partnership

President Gurbanguly Berdimuhamedov met with the State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of India Mobashar Javed Akbar who arrived in Turkmenistan as a head of representative delegation of his country for the participation in coming ceremonies. Having expressed the gratitude for warm and cordial welcome, high ranking guest conveyed the greetings and best wishes of the leaders of the Republic of India to the Head of the State and to all Turkmen people. Having addressed return greetings to the highest officials of friendly state, the President of Turkmenistan highlighted that our nations are connected by historical, spiritual and cultural roots that go far to the centuries. India has always been and remains to be important partner of our country, to cooperation with which special attention is paid. Share of the opinions on priority subjects of interstate cooperation took place during the conversation. In this context, the role of high-level meetings in the development of traditional friendly relations between the countries as well as in the issues of political and diplomatic collaboration including under international organizations has been mentioned. Trade and economic sphere, transport and communication, health protection, high technologies, textile industry and number of other spheres have been mentioned among topical directions of the partnership. In this regard, the importance of Interstate Turkmen – Indian Commission of trade, economic, scientific and technology cooperation has been highlighted. In addition, the necessity of continuation of the practice of bilateral meetings on different levels, which allows defining priority vectors of cooperation that is built on equality and mutual benefits, has been mentioned. Perspectives of the cooperation in fuel and energy sector, where special place is allocated to the realization of the project of construction of Turkmenistan – Afghanistan – Pakistan – India gas pipeline, were separate subject of discussion. Building of transnational gas main is economically beneficial for all participants of this project, President Gurbanguly Berdimuhamedov said, having highlighted that TAPI is to make considerable contribution to stable social and economic development of the states in Asian region and generally to support the consolidation of global energy security. Mabashar Javed Akbar highlighted keen interest of his country in the supplies of Turkmen natural gas what was conditioned by growing requirements of intensively developing Indian economy in energy carriers. Having noted that implementation of TAPI project would support the consolidation of Turkmen – Indian cooperation that is built on the principles of constructive partnership and long terms, Turkmen leader and his guest confirmed mutual intent to accelerate the realization of this project and the willingness to take all necessary measures for these purposes. Having touched upon the subject of the partnership in transport and communication sphere, the State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of India highlighted the importance of the projects of construction of railway corridors initiated by our country, particularly Serhetabat – Turgundy railroad that is planned to be opened as well as the launch of construction of international power and fibre optic lines that bring the progress to entire region. In addition, the role of traditional cultural and humanitarian contacts in the consolidation of friendly and trustful relations of both nations has been highlighted.
